The big win for the Republican party came in the way of local races. Sure, the GOP gained 63 seats in the House of Representatives and six in the Senate but the long-term win was the nearly 700 state legislative seats now in the GOP. This means Republicans will have a big advantage when redistricting happens after reapportionment based on the 2010 census.
